Synopsis
Captain William Laurence and his extraordinary dragon, Temeraire, find themselves at the heart of a desperate struggle for control of Europe. With the British Isles under unprecedented threat and Napoleon's dragon-borne forces poised for conquest, their duty to defend their homeland clashes with the rigid societal structures that often bind them.
